Web8 aug. 2024 · The good news is that you can use baking soda mixed with vinegar to keep your linoleum floor clean. Baking soda is found to be very effective when it comes to … WebStart by getting vinegar, baking soda, a bowl of water, and rags ready and head to the rust stained area. Spread a layer of baking soda over the rust stain and wet your rag with the vinegar. Web8 aug. 2024 · Check out the following methods you can try to eliminate rust stains from your linoleum floors. For commercial rust remover: Wash the affected area with a solution of warm water and liquid detergent. Apply the rust remover and make sure you carefully follow all the instructions indicated on the label. Web31 mrt. 2024 · Method 1: Lemon Juice and Epsom Salt Method. Pour lemon juice on the affected areas. Sprinkle salt on the affected areas. Allow the mixture to sit for a few hours. Scrub the mixture away. Rinse the tub with warm water. Method 2: Baking Soda Method. Make the baking soda paste. Apply the paste to the tub. Spray or pour 3 or 4 percent hydrogen peroxide on the stained area, then agitate it with a stone-safe granite cleaning pad or nylon brush. Allow this to sit for 24 hours, then rinse it with water. If the stain remains, it may be time to call in the professionals for repairs. building a scalextric layoutWebUsing vinegar and soda is a very effective way of removing rust from the vinyl flooring.
